motherboard Asus IPIBL-LB (BENICIA-GL8E)
CPU-Q6600 quad core
sapphire 6870
Doing some research I learned that my motherboard can have up to 8gb of total ram (Vista home 64 bit). Im currently running a total of 4gb of ram now. I wanted to upgrade since ram appears to be pretty cheap and hope to see some performance increase. Memory upgrade specs
•
Dual channel memory architecture
•
Four 240-pin DDR2 DIMM sockets
•
Supported DIMM types:
◦
PC2-5300 (667 MHz)
◦
PC2-6400 (800 MHz)
•
Non-ECC memory only, unbuffered
•
Supports 2GB DDR2 DIMMs
•
Supports up to 8 GB on 64 bit PCs
•
Supports up to 4 GB* on 32 bit PCs
